Top 5 Virtual Pet Apps Performance in Italy, Q3 2024
Explore the performance of Italy's top virtual pet apps in Q3 2024, highlighting tr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2024, Italy's virtual pet app market showcased some intriguing trends across the top five applications on a unified platform, as revealed by Sensor Tower data.
My Talking Hank: Islands from Outfit7 Limited saw a notable fluctuation in its weekly revenue, initially peaking at around $30K in mid-July, before dipping to $9K by the end of September. Downloads started high at around 39K in mid-July but gradually decreased to approximately 3.7K by the quarter's end. The app's weekly active users mirrored this trend, starting at 80K and declining to about 24.9K.
My Talking Tom 2 maintained a strong presence, with revenue peaking at $129K in late July and stabilizing around $63K by September's close. Downloads fluctuated, starting at 15K, dipping to 9K in early July, and then recovering to over 11K by the end of the quarter. The app consistently engaged around 140K weekly active users throughout the quarter.
My Talking Angela 2 also from Outfit7 Limited, reported consistent weekly revenue, with a peak of $297K in mid-August and closing the quarter at $242K. Downloads showed a slight decline, starting from 14K in early July and ending with 10K in late September. Active user engagement saw a decline from 72K to 60K over the quarter.
My Talking Tom Friends experienced a revenue peak of $455K in late July, tapering to $203K by the end of September. The app's downloads started at 15K, experiencing a decline to 6.2K by the quarter's end. However, it maintained a robust active user base, fluctuating around 180K throughout the period.
Finally, Bruno - My Super Slime Pet by Dramaton LTD, displayed an upward trend in revenue, peaking at $71K in mid-August before tapering off to $19K by September. Downloads saw a peak of 12K in mid-August, declining to 6K by the end of the quarter. The app's weekly active users remained steady, peaking at 79K in late August and ending at 67.8K.
